Professor D. R. Grischkowsky Awarded Honorary Professor of Tianjin University
|
Professor D. R. Grischkowsky from Okalahoma State University was awarded an honorary professorship at Tianjin University on April 10, 2008. President GONG Ke met with Professor Grischkowsky.
Discussions were made on collaboration between TU and OSU in the field of Terahertz Waves. Professor Grischkowsky said he would come to TU at least once a year to help advance the research on Terahertz Waves here.
During his stay at TU, Professor Grischkowsky attended the 4th International Symposium on Ultrafast Phenomena & Terahertz Waves and gave a keynote speech.
Professor D. R. Grischkowsky has published more than 140 refereed journal articles in his career. His work is internationally respected and very widely cited, and he is well known as an active leader and scholar in his field of ultrafast nonlinear optics and terahertz radiation.
Dr. Grischkowsky has been elected to Fellow status in three professional societies (American Physical Society, Optical Society of America, and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ers), and has won three prestigious international
scientific prizes, including the Boris Pregel Award for Applied Science and Technology, from the New York Academy of Sciences, the R. W. Wood Prize, from the Optical Society of America, and in 2003 the William F. Meggers Award, from the Optical Society of America.
